Polypropylene Foam Plastics Market Synopsis

 

Polypropylene Foam Plastics Market Size Was Valued at USD 15.6 Billion in 2023, and is Projected to Reach USD 43.96 Billion by 2032, Growing at a CAGR of 12.2% From 2024-2032.

 

Polypropylene Foam Plastics market: The Polypropylene foam plastics market relates to the business of manufacturing, selling and employing all foam products produced from foam polypropylene material. Polypropylene (PP) is an economical thermoplastic belonging to the polyolefin group and is highly valued due to its foldability and durability. Polypropylene when converted to foam form, delivers other value-added qualities like superior insulation, sound absorption capacity, more cushioning and lighter weight, which are desirable in sectors including packaging, automotive, construction and other sectors. Polyppropylene foam plastics are manufactured through facilities such as extrusion, molding and foaming methods. Some of the characteristic features of these materials are non toxicity, biodegradability, recyclability, moisture and chemical resistant, and a relatively long shelf life. Restraint: Price Volatility of Raw Materials

 

The Polypropylene Foam Plastics Market is faced with some constraints that inhibit its growth including the fluctuating price of raw materials. Polypropylene like all products that are derived from petrochemicals is vulnerable to volatility in raw material prices meaning that any volatility in raw material prices affects the cost structure of foam manufacturing. Polypropylene’s cost is often pegged on aspects like crude oil prices, production disruptions, and geopolitical events all of which pose risks on the material price volatility. Such price fluctuations are known to cause fluctuations in production costs, and therefore influence the pricing mechanism used by manufacturers. Also, the cost of energy needed in the production of foam plastics has gone up, which compunds these issues. These challenges may affect manufacturers’ profitability and such costs may have to be transferred to the consumer, which will affect growth.

By Type, Extruded Polypropylene Foam Plastics segment is expected to dominate the market during the forecast period

 

The extruded polypropylene foam plastics segment is expected to remain the largest market segment during the forecast period. This type polypropylene foam is made through the extrusion process by which the polypropylene resin is melted and then forced through a mold to come up with foam material that runs in parallel to the direction of flow. The extruded foam is lightweight, more or less resistant to shocks, and provides excellent cushioning for a multitude of uses in automotive, packaging, and construction industries. Also, extruded polypropylene foam shows better dimensional stability in respect to thickness and density and, therefore, excellent for precision parts applications and products that demand uniformity.

 

Plastic foam packaged in polypropylene foaming types shed light into extruded polypropylene foam plastics by filling the markets due to affordable pricing and multi-functionality. The most obvious advantage of the extrusion process is that there are many possibilities of shaping and sizing foam products, making it easier to custom the foam to the requirements of various sectors. However, extruded polypropylene foam can be effectively modified with additives in order to obtain desired characteristics like flame, UV, and acoustic properties, so this material has the highest demand in automotive applications, packaging, and construction industries. By Application, Automotive segment expected to held the largest share 

 

The automotive segment will maintain its largest market share of the Polypropylene Foam Plastics market within the given time span. Polypropylene foam plastics can be used in automobile industry Several automobile manufacturing companies have in recent years being using polypropylene foam plastics to make products for automobile manufacturing because it is light hence adds little weight on the automobile thus improving on its fuel economy. Polypropylene foam possesses the ability to reduce weight: it is also characterized by high thermal and sound insulating qualities, so it can be used in automotive industry for manufacture of seat cushionings, headrests, door linings and dashboard. Thus, the trends in the automotive industry toward lowering emissions and increasing energy density and efficiency have had the most influence on the development of polypropylene foam usage.

 

Another advantage of polypropylene foam is also its high impact strength in a situation of accident as compared to that of polyurethane foam. This is one of the key factors influencing the increase use in automotive industry. Also to this, the increased utilization of electric vehicles (EVs), which come with lighter weight to afford optimum energy utilization, strengthens the polypropylene foam market in automotive products.
